Description
The Sijwa Project is the re-purposing and re-inventing of all recyclable waste from the African Monarch Lodges; Nambwa Tented Lodge, Kazile Island Lodge and from the local community, into exquisite saleable craft and art. It is also home to permaculture gardens, an indigenous tree nursery, a cultural centre and a junior ranger school.
